Hedge funds are doubling down on Big Tech even after summer volatility triggered a massive portfolio cleanup

Hedge funds are still heavily invested in Big Tech despite a significant portfolio overhaul during the summer's market volatility. These funds are now looking to diversify by investing in sectors like healthcare, energy, and financials. This shift suggests they're seeking stability and growth beyond the tech sector, which could indicate a broader trend in how these high-stakes investors are navigating market uncertainties and looking for new opportunities.
